What are cross-chain swaps?

Created by Ethos Support, Modified on Fri, 24 May at 11:32 AM by Ethos Support

Cross-chain swaps, also known as atomic swaps or cross-chain transactions, are decentralized exchanges of digital assets between different blockchain networks without the need for intermediaries. They enable users to trade cryptocurrencies directly from one blockchain to another, allowing for interoperability and asset transfers between disparate blockchain ecosystems.


Here's how cross-chain swaps typically work:


Initiation: The process begins when two parties agree to exchange assets across different blockchain networks. Each party specifies the amount and type of cryptocurrency they want to exchange.

Hash Time Locked Contracts (HTLCs): Both parties create and lock their respective funds into Hash Time Locked Contracts (HTLCs) on their respective blockchain networks. An HTLC is a smart contract that requires a preimage (a cryptographic hash) to be revealed within a certain time frame for the contract to be executed.

Cross-Chain Communication: The parties communicate and share the necessary information, including the hash of the preimage, to facilitate the swap across the two blockchain networks.

Verification and Execution: Once the necessary information is shared, each party can independently verify the details and initiate the swap. By revealing the preimage, the HTLCs are fulfilled simultaneously, allowing the assets to be swapped directly between the two parties without the need for a trusted intermediary.

Completion: Once the swap is completed, both parties receive the swapped assets in their respective blockchain wallets, and the transaction is settled on both blockchain networks.

Cross-chain swaps offer several advantages:


Decentralization: Cross-chain swaps are decentralized, meaning they do not rely on centralized exchanges or intermediaries to facilitate transactions. This reduces counterparty risk and reliance on third parties.

Interoperability: Cross-chain swaps enable interoperability between different blockchain networks, allowing users to access and exchange assets across disparate ecosystems.

Privacy: Since cross-chain swaps occur directly between parties without the need for intermediaries, they can offer increased privacy and anonymity compared to centralized exchanges.

Security: Cross-chain swaps are secured by cryptographic techniques such as HTLCs, ensuring that funds are only released if the conditions of the smart contract are met by both parties.

Overall, cross-chain swaps play a crucial role in enabling seamless asset transfers and interoperability between blockchain networks, fostering greater adoption and utility of cryptocurrencies and decentralized applications (DApps).

Was this article helpful?

That’s Great!

Thank you for your feedback

Sorry! We couldn't be helpful

Thank you for your feedback

Let us know how can we improve this article!

Select at least one of the reasons
CAPTCHA verification is required.

Feedback sent

We appreciate your effort and will try to fix the article